summ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Cole Robinson <crobinso@redhat.com>2013-05-09 20:07:29 -0400
committerCole Robinson <crobinso@redhat.com>2013-05-09 20:07:29 -0400
commitb68faac8e825ef808e9fb70e3b5563c2774d0fbb (patch)
tree20a6e11299282c7f2d432b317d360d34a833f8e7
parentd8deda4264161e90213641ac7490cc6291e8bedc (diff)
downloadvirt-manager-b68faac8e825ef808e9fb70e3b5563c2774d0fbb.tar.gz
Fix crash when creating guest from ISO media (bz 958641)
Accessing another unknown gsettings key. Should be the last one though...
-rw-r--r--data/org.virt-manager.virt-manager.gschema.xml7
-rw-r--r--virtManager/config.py4
2 files changed, 9 insertions, 2 deletions
diff --git a/data/org.virt-manager.virt-manager.gschema.xml b/data/org.virt-manager.virt-manager.gschema.xml
index b1a11e3c..2e4664fa 100644
--- a/data/org.virt-manager.virt-manager.gschema.xml
+++ b/data/org.virt-manager.virt-manager.gschema.xml
@@ -211,6 +211,13 @@
<summary>Default screenshot path</summary>
<description>Default path for saving screenshots from VMs</description>
</key>
+
+ <key name="perms-fix-ignore" type="b">
+ <default>false</default>
+ <summary>Ask about fixing permissions</summary>
+ <description>Whether to ask about fixing path permissions</description>
+ </key>
+
</schema>
<schema id="org.virt-manager.virt-manager.confirm" path="/org/virt-manager/virt-manager/confirm/">
diff --git a/virtManager/config.py b/virtManager/config.py
index f26d7d33..52f4142f 100644
--- a/virtManager/config.py
+++ b/virtManager/config.py
@@ -467,9 +467,9 @@ class vmmConfig(object):
if path in current_list:
continue
current_list.append(path)
- self.conf.set("/paths/perms_fix_ignore", current_list)
+ self.conf.set("/paths/perms-fix-ignore", current_list)
def get_perms_fix_ignore(self):
- return self.conf.get("/paths/perms_fix_ignore")
+ return self.conf.get("/paths/perms-fix-ignore")
# Manager view connection list